Understanding Ear Infections and Their Causes
Ear infections, medically known as otitis media, are among the most common ailments affecting infants and young children. These infections occur when fluid builds up behind the eardrum, often caused by bacteria or viruses invading the middle ear. The resulting inflammation leads to pain, fever, and sometimes temporary hearing loss. While ear infections can affect people of all ages, children under three years old are particularly vulnerable due to their developing immune systems and shorter, more horizontal Eustachian tubes that allow easier bacterial access.
The primary culprits behind ear infections are respiratory viruses such as influenza or respiratory syncytial virus (RSV), as well as bacteria like Streptococcus pneumoniae and Haemophilus influenzae. These pathogens can enter the middle ear following a cold or upper respiratory infection. Environmental factors such as exposure to tobacco smoke, daycare attendance, and bottle-feeding in a supine position also increase susceptibility.
Given how common ear infections are—studies suggest nearly 80% of children experience at least one by age three—parents often seek natural remedies alongside medical treatments. The Composition of Breast Milk: Nature’s Immune Booster
Breast milk is a complex biological fluid designed to nourish infants while offering robust immune protection. It contains a rich mixture of antibodies, immune cells, enzymes, hormones, and nutrients tailored to support infant health.
Key immunological components include:
- Immunoglobulin A (IgA): This antibody coats mucous membranes in the respiratory and gastrointestinal tracts to prevent pathogen attachment.
- Lysozyme: An enzyme that breaks down bacterial cell walls.
- Lactoferrin: Binds iron needed by bacteria, inhibiting their growth.
- Leukocytes: White blood cells capable of attacking pathogens directly.
- Cytokines and growth factors: Modulate immune responses and promote tissue repair.
These components collectively help reduce infection risk by neutralizing harmful microbes before they can establish an infection. For infants who rely on breast milk exclusively during their first six months, this immune support is vital in preventing various illnesses—including respiratory infections that often lead to ear infections.
How Breast Milk’s Antibodies Work Against Ear Infection Pathogens
The IgA antibodies in breast milk specifically target pathogens commonly responsible for ear infections. When breastfed babies swallow milk containing these antibodies, it coats their upper respiratory tract and digestive system. This coating blocks bacteria like Streptococcus pneumoniae from adhering to mucosal surfaces—a critical first step in infection development.
Moreover, lactoferrin deprives bacteria of iron necessary for replication. Lysozyme disrupts bacterial structures directly. These mechanisms reduce bacterial load around the Eustachian tube opening—the pathway connecting the throat to the middle ear—thus lowering chances of bacterial migration into the middle ear cavity.
The Evidence: Does Breast Milk Help Ear Infections?
Scientific research provides compelling evidence that breastfeeding decreases both the incidence and severity of ear infections in infants. Numerous observational studies have tracked health outcomes among breastfed versus formula-fed babies.
One landmark study published in Pediatrics analyzed over 4,000 children and found that those exclusively breastfed for at least six months had a significantly lower risk of developing otitis media compared to those who were formula-fed or mixed-fed. The protective effect remained even after adjusting for confounding factors such as socioeconomic status and exposure to tobacco smoke.
Another meta-analysis reviewing multiple studies concluded that breastfeeding reduced otitis media episodes by about 50% during infancy. The protective benefit appeared dose-dependent; longer durations of exclusive breastfeeding correlated with greater reductions in infection rates.
Limitations: Breast Milk Is Not a Cure-All
Despite these benefits, it’s crucial to recognize that breast milk is not a guaranteed cure for existing ear infections. Once an infection has established itself inside the middle ear space with fluid buildup and inflammation, simply applying or ingesting breast milk will not eliminate it.
Clinical treatment often requires antibiotics or other interventions depending on severity. Breastfeeding supports overall immune defense but cannot replace medical care when an active infection causes pain or hearing issues.
Practical Uses: Can Applying Breast Milk Help Ear Infection Symptoms?
Some parents wonder if applying expressed breast milk directly into the infant’s ear canal might relieve symptoms or fight infection locally. This practice has roots in traditional home remedies but lacks strong scientific backing.
Theoretically, antimicrobial components in breast milk could offer some benefit if they reach infected tissues directly. However:
- The external auditory canal is separate from the middle ear space where infection resides; topical application may have limited effect beyond surface cleaning.
- Introducing any liquid into an inflamed or perforated eardrum risks worsening symptoms or causing irritation.
- No clinical trials have conclusively demonstrated safety or efficacy for this method.
Therefore, while breastfeeding itself supports systemic immunity against future infections, applying breast milk into ears should be approached cautiously and only after consulting a healthcare provider.

The Role of Breastfeeding Duration and Exclusivity on Ear Health
Longer periods of exclusive breastfeeding correlate with stronger protection against otitis media. Infants fed solely on breast milk for six months typically develop fewer episodes than those introduced early to formula or solid foods.
Exclusivity matters because formula lacks immune components present in human milk. Introducing formula dilutes antibody intake and may alter gut microbiota composition—both factors influencing systemic immunity.
Some studies suggest even partial breastfeeding offers benefits compared to no breastfeeding at all; however, risks rise as duration shortens or exclusivity decreases. Therefore:
- Aim for exclusive breastfeeding during the first six months when possible.
- If exclusive breastfeeding isn’t feasible, continue partial breastfeeding alongside formula feeding.
- Avoid early introduction of bottle feeding while lying down to reduce fluid reflux into Eustachian tubes.
These practices optimize natural defenses against respiratory pathogens linked to ear infections.
The Immune System Beyond Breast Milk: Other Factors Influencing Ear Infection Risk
While breastfeeding plays a significant role in protecting infants from otitis media, it’s one piece of a larger puzzle involving multiple environmental and genetic factors:
- Tobacco Smoke Exposure: Children exposed to secondhand smoke have higher rates of recurrent ear infections due to mucosal irritation and impaired immunity.
- Daycare Attendance: Group settings increase viral transmission leading to more upper respiratory tract illnesses triggering secondary ear infections.
- Anatomical Variations: Some children have narrower Eustachian tubes predisposing them to fluid buildup regardless of feeding method.
- Vaccinations: Pneumococcal conjugate vaccines reduce bacterial causes of otitis media significantly.
Combining breastfeeding with avoidance of smoke exposure and up-to-date immunizations provides comprehensive defense against frequent or severe ear infections.
The Microbiome Connection: How Breast Milk Shapes Infant Immunity Long-Term
Emerging research highlights how breast milk influences gut microbiota development—critical for training infant immune systems beyond infancy. A balanced microbiome supports systemic anti-inflammatory responses reducing susceptibility not only to gut diseases but also respiratory tract infections including otitis media.
Breastfed infants tend to harbor beneficial bacteria like Bifidobacteria which enhance mucosal barrier function throughout the body. These effects extend beyond mere nutrition; they represent lasting immunological programming helping protect ears indirectly over time.
Treatment Considerations When an Ear Infection Occurs Despite Breastfeeding
Even with optimal breastfeeding practices, some infants will develop otitis media requiring medical intervention:
- Pain Management: Over-the-counter analgesics such as acetaminophen or ibuprofen alleviate discomfort effectively.
- Antibiotics: Prescribed only when bacterial infection is confirmed or symptoms persist beyond two days due to concerns about resistance.
- Myringotomy Tubes: For recurrent cases causing hearing impairment or speech delays—small tubes inserted into eardrums help ventilate middle ears.
Continuing breastfeeding during illness remains beneficial by supporting immunity and hydration but should complement—not replace—appropriate medical care.
